    Come learn more about Palliative Care and how this specialty service can focus on providing patients who have a serious illness with relief from pain and other associated symptoms. Palliative Care can provide an extra layer of support for patients and is appropriate at any age and at any stage in a serious illness and...

    The Blue Zones are longevity hotspots, regions of the world where current evidence indicates people live much longer and healthier than average. This discussion will include lessons learned that could have significant implications for cancer patients and survivors.
